An Example from History: The Salem Witch Trials
The infamous Salem Witch Trials of 1692 provide a striking illustration of how rumours can spiral out of control, ultimately leading to a tragic outcome. In this dark chapter of American history, whispers began to circulate, accusing innocent individuals of practicing witchcraft. Fuelled by the fervor of a deeply religious community, these rumours spread like an unstoppable virus and led to the trial and execution of numerous men and women. Lives were forever shattered due to the power of unfounded rumours, resulting in a haunting reminder of the destructive potential they possess.
The Role of Propaganda in Shaping Events
Unfortunately, rumours are not always mere instances of mischief or idle gossip. In some instances, they are carefully crafted tools of propaganda, wielded by those in power to manipulate public opinion and preserve their authority. In times of war, for example, rumours can be instrumental in sowing seeds of discontent or fear within enemy territories. These disinformation campaigns aim to weaken morale, disrupt supply chains, and undermine the enemy’s resolve. Such tactics have been employed by both ancient and modern societies, highlighting the enduring power of rumours in influencing the outcome of conflicts.
The Modern Age: Rumours in the Digital Era
With the advent of the internet and social media, rumours have acquired an unprecedented ability to spread rapidly and influence events on a global scale. The digital era has provided us with a platform where rumours can be disseminated within seconds. Misinformation and disinformation campaigns can quickly erode trust in institutions, sway public opinion, and even have real-world consequences. A single tweet or a misleading article has the potential to spark controversy, unrest, or even a diplomatic crisis. These modern tools of communication have amplified the already formidable force of rumours, demanding that we remain vigilant in the face of their influence.

FAQs
1. Are rumours always harmful?
Rumours can have both positive and negative consequences. While they can generate excitement or hope, they also have the potential to cause prejudice, panic, and harm innocent individuals. It is essential to critically evaluate rumours and verify their accuracy to prevent unnecessary consequences.
2. How can rumours be debunked?
To debunk a rumour, one must engage in thorough fact-checking. Relying on reputable sources, such as credible news outlets, expert opinions, or verified research, can help distinguish between truth and falsehood. Sharing accurate information and encouraging open dialogue can also help dispel rumours.
3. How can we protect ourselves from the influence of rumours?
To protect ourselves from the influence of rumours, it is important to cultivate critical thinking skills. This involves questioning information, seeking multiple sources, and remaining skeptical until claims can be substantiated. Promoting media literacy and educating ourselves about the biases and motives behind information sources can also aid in safeguarding against the influence of rumours.
